POSITION SUMMARY: Under general supervision of the Deputy Director of the Special Education Unit, with latitude for independent initiative and judgment, performs responsible work in the supervision and/or performance of various outreach work related to the Legal Services Special Education Initiative; performs assigned tasks to ensure the delivery and implementation of special education services. Performs related work.
REPORTS TO: Managing Attorney, Office of Legal Services – Special Education Unit
DIRECT REPORTS: Field and Central SEU Legal Associate staff
KEY RELATIONSHIPS: The Special Education Legal Coordinator will work closely with the Special Education Managing Attorney and other Legal Services staff in support of special education personnel.
